Car Hit By Another Vehicle..

do I need to contact 21st century or the person's insurance company that hit my car? Or both?

It's a good idea to contact both insurance companies, so they both know your side of what happened. If the driver who hit you contacts his insurance company, that will start the claim process, but his version of what happened may differ from your version.

You don't necessarily need to contact your insurance company if you are going to go through his insurance company for the damages, however it's a good idea to let your insurance company know what happened, in case you need their help with the claim down the road.
